I built a simple framed stand from 2x4’s. Like most, it’s overkill, but lumber is cheap.

I used the tank to lay out the holes for the drains and returns.

I was planning to bump it up tight against the wall, so holes and notches for wiring were cut.

Image

The tank sits on a thin layer of foam and a plywood panel.
